Handover — Image Cache Leak (Corvid SDK)

Plugin-facing note: the Corvid image cache leaks when plugins hold decoded bitmaps past the eviction callback. Fix shipped in the latest SDK; release your references in `onEvict`. Older plugins get a compatibility shim with a hard memory ceiling — hitting it flushes the whole cache, so expect thumbnail repaints. The shim and eviction behavior are tunable via the host config, shown below.

config for kafof-bawef:
holath:
  log_level: debug
  metrics_host: metrics.holath.qorvelsys.internal
  pin: 2191
  pool_size: 32

Ticket: Missed pick-up — notarised deed

The scheduled collection of the notarised deed for the Brellin Quay property did not occur this morning; the driver from Castermere Couriers logged the stop as inaccessible due to a closed loading bay. The document remains sealed in the registry cabinet at the Folwick office. A replacement pick-up is booked for tomorrow before noon. Please brief the assigned driver on the confidential hand-over instruction below.

dispatch memo: the ulaox normir courier leaves the praath ledger at gate 9753 under passcode 639705

### Step 4: Update the autoscaler

After migrating the queues to Brineworks v3, the Spindlevane queue-depth autoscaler must be repointed. Its old polling targets no longer exist, and leaving them in place causes scale-to-zero flapping. Update the target definitions, then restart the controller so it picks up the new metrics endpoint. Verify scaling events appear in the Harrowgate dashboard within five minutes. Apply the following configuration before restarting.

settings of yageg-yahap:
[gorael]
team = olieth
access_code = ac_941d74
owner = brieth.aldiel
host = gorael.tolvaqio.internal
port = 6379
peer = briwyn.urlaqtech.internal
salt = 116e6622
pin = 1957